## Build Provenance: Payroll Export v4

The Harkwell payroll export moved from fixed-width to delimited records in v4. Every export now embeds provenance: which pipeline built it, from which commit, on which runner at the Dornfield cluster. New folks: never hand-edit an export. If finance questions a file, pull its provenance record first. Provenance checks are mandatory before re-running any v4 job. Each provenance record begins with the build token shown below.

pipeline stamp: htk3_69f

Handover for the weekly eng sync: I'm transferring ownership of Duskrunner, our nightly backfill scheduler, to Priya. Current state: all jobs healthy except the ledger-reconciliation backfill, which retries once nightly due to a slow upstream from the Kestwick warehouse. Retry logic, window sizing, and concurrency caps were all tuned carefully last quarter — please don't change them without a load test. For full transparency at the sync, the production instance runs with these configuration values.

settings of hawep-kadug:
RALAEL_HOST=ralael.tolvaqlabs.internal
RALAEL_PORT=9000

Flagging this for future maintainers: the gating rules in `canary_gate.rs` look arbitrary but were derived from the Pellworth incident, where a canary with a 2% error rate passed because the observation window was too short. We deliberately require both a minimum sample count and a sustained-window check before promotion; changing either alone reintroduces that failure mode. The thresholds, windows, and rollback triggers are captured in the constants below.

tuning constants:
QUOTAS = {
    "druwyn": 5,
    "holix": 5,
    "zorath": 5,
    "holwyn": 10,
}

**Mgmt Meeting Minutes — Retiring the Brightline Range**

Quick recap for sales leads at Fenholt Supplies: we agreed to retire the Brightline fixture range by year-end. Remaining stock moves to clearance pricing next month, and accounts on standing orders get migrated to the Lumetta range. Trade-in incentives were approved in principle. The confidential note on next steps sits just below.

board note of bajof-bajeg: The pricing group signed off on a budget of $13.4 million for Project Sildor. The renewal with Lamixek Holdings closes at $48.9 million a year, 49 percent above the last contract.